What is Mount Kenya National Park?

Mount Kenya National Park is a protected area that covers more than 1,000 square kilometers around Mount Kenya. Established in 1949, the national park is home to many species of animals, birds, and plants. It has an elevation of over 5,000 meters and offers a unique and picturesque landscape.

How do I get to Mount Kenya National Park?

Mount Kenya National Park is accessible from a few different sides, but the easiest route to the park is from Nanyuki. Nanyuki has an airstrip and can be reached by road from Nairobi, which is about 150 kilometers away. You can fly to Nanyuki or choose to take a public or private taxi or bus.

What is the best time to visit Mount Kenya National Park?

The best time to visit Mount Kenya National Park is during the dry season, which runs from January to March and from July to October. During these times, there is little rainfall, and the weather is ideal for hiking and other outdoor activities. However, the park is open throughout the year.

What activities are available in Mount Kenya National Park?

Mount Kenya National Park offers various activities, including wildlife watching, birdwatching, and hiking. You can choose to hike up the mountain, explore the alpine forests or visit the nearby lakes. The park is also home to large mammals such as buffalo, elephant, and rhinoceros.
